6.3. Adding a global forwarder in the CLI
Follow this procedure to add a global DNS forwarder by using the command line (CLI).
Prerequisites
- You are logged in as IdM administrator.
- You know the Internet Protocol (IP) address of the DNS server to forward queries to.
Procedure
Use the
ipa dnsconfig-modcommand to add a new global forwarder. Specify the IP address of the DNS forwarder with the--forwarderoption.[user@server ~]$ ipa dnsconfig-mod --forwarder=10.10.0.1 Server will check DNS forwarder(s). This may take some time, please wait ... Global forwarders: 10.10.0.1 IPA DNS servers: server.example.com
Verification
Use the
dnsconfig-showcommand to display global forwarders.[user@server ~]$ ipa dnsconfig-show Global forwarders: 10.10.0.1 IPA DNS servers: server.example.com
